High Noon, based in the San Francisco Bay Area, is comprised of Ryan Neergaard (vocals) Ian Devereux White (guitar),  Brandon Cherry (drums) and features Nik Blankenship (Bass). A high power, melody and rhythm focused rock band with strong 70’s and 90’s influences. High Noon has been compared to the Red Hot Chili Peppers, Stone Temple Pilots, Oasis, and credits mix of classic rock bands from Led Zeppelin to Tom Petty as their influences. 

 

Often found at bay area concert venues, wineries, breweries and distilleries, this down to earth group loves playing live and is driven by crowd energy, their love of music, and their friendship. High Noon recently played the Ukraine benefit concert in Napa Valley at the fairgrounds with the Stone Foxes and Grammy Award Winning artist Fantastic Negrito, which raised over $100,000, 100% distributed directly to verified Ukraine foundations. Thousands attended, the event was covered by Channel 2 and other news channels, who focused on High Noon and their music; specifically their acclaimed single "Preacher Man”.

 

Songs from High Noons 6-song EP “Swell” will debut April 8 at JaM Cellars, featuring the acclaimed single Preacher Man and new single Wheels Down. The EP will release at Bottlerock Napa Valley in May 2023. The band will also be headlining Auction Napa Valley, the most prestigious consumer event of the year in Napa Valley, and has upcoming gigs at the Blue Note and other loved bay area venues.
